Cost of assisted living in Leaf, GA

The average cost of senior living in Leaf is $4,125 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Hiawassee, GA with an average of $3,318 per month.

The table below shows how monthly assisted living costs in Leaf have changed in the last two years and how those changes compare with state and national trends. The figures represent averages of actual costs paid by seniors who moved into A Place for Mom partner communities in 2023 and 2024.

Cost comparison table showing 2023 and 2024 median costs by location. This table contains 3 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column location: Location
Column cost2024: 2024 average cost
Column cost2023: 2023 average cost
Column percentChange: Percent change
Location2024 average cost2023 average costPercent change
Leaf, GA$4,365/mo$4,279/mo+2.0%
Georgia$4,320/mo$4,115/mo+5.0%
National$5,375/mo$5,129/mo+4.8%

State regulations for assisted living in Leaf

Safety is a primary concern when seniors and their families look for assisted living. Each state has its own laws and inspection processes to help ensure seniors reside in a safe environment and receive quality care. Learning about Georgia assisted living regulations will help you understand how assisted living communities in Leaf protect seniors.
